Archean Chemical Industries Limited, together with its subsidiaries, is one of India’s leading specialty marine chemical companies, primarily engaged in the manufacturing and exporting of bromine, industrial salt, and sulphate of potash (SOP). The company leverages the unique brine reserves of the Rann of Kutch to produce high-quality marine chemicals that are critical inputs for industries such as pharmaceuticals, agrochemicals, flame retardants, water treatment, oil and gas, and glass. The company’s product portfolio also includes bromine derivatives, which are seeing increasing demand from compound semiconductors and energy storage solutions.

Archean Chemical Industries Limited is an Indian specialty marine chemical company engaged in the manufacturing and exporting of bromine, industrial salt, and sulphate of potash. The company was originally formed as a partnership firm under the name Archean Chemical Industries in Chennai, pursuant to a partnership deed dated November 20, 2003. The company was incorporated as a public limited company on July 14, 2009, with the Registrar of Companies in Chennai, Tamil Nadu. The company has its registered office in Chennai, Tamil Nadu, India. Archean Chemical Industries is widely known for being one of the largest producers of bromine in India, leveraging the unique brine reserves of the Rann of Kutch. The company has integrated its operations across the extraction, processing, and downstream derivative segments, making it a key player in the marine chemicals value chain. Over the years, it has diversified its product portfolio to include bromine derivatives, catering to high-growth sectors such as compound semiconductors, energy storage, and flame retardants. The company generates a majority of its revenue from overseas markets, reflecting its strong export orientation and global customer base.
Archean Chemical Industries operates in the global specialty chemicals industry, specifically the marine chemicals and bromine segment. Globally, the specialty chemicals market continues to expand driven by increasing demand from end-user industries such as pharmaceuticals, agrochemicals, electronics, and water treatment. In India, the specialty chemicals industry is one of the fastest-growing segments within the broader chemical sector, supported by the government‘s ‘Make in India’ initiative, rising domestic consumption, and growing export opportunities. The Indian specialty chemicals market size reached USD 67.0 billion in 2025 and is expected to reach USD 93.4 billion by 2034, exhibiting a growth rate (CAGR) of 3.65% during 2026-2034. The global bromine market is projected to reach USD 3.7 billion by 2030, driven by increasing demand for flame retardants, oil and gas drilling, and water treatment applications. The bromine derivatives market is also witnessing strong growth, particularly for applications in electric vehicles and energy storage systems. Key growth drivers include increasing demand for bromine-based flame retardants, the shift towards electric vehicles requiring bromine-based components, rising pharmaceutical and agrochemical production, and government support for domestic chemical manufacturing. The industry faces challenges including raw material price volatility, environmental compliance requirements, and intense competition from global players. However, the industry outlook remains positive, supported by sustained demand for specialty chemicals, export growth, and increasing focus on high-value derivatives.
Archean Chemical Industries Limited is actively traded on India‘s principal equity markets, with its shares listed on the National Stock Exchange of India (NSE) under the symbol ACI and on the Bombay Stock Exchange (BSE) with the scrip code 543657. The ISIN number of the company’s equity shares is INE128X01021. The face value of the equity shares is ₹2 per share. The company was listed on November 21, 2022, following its IPO. Its listing on both exchanges ensures that the Archean Chemical price is accessible to a wide investor base, encompassing both retail and institutional market participants. The company forms part of several benchmark indices that represent broad market segments. Archean Chemical Industries is included in indices such as the BSE 500, BSE AllCap, BSE SmallCap, BSE Chemicals, and Nifty Smallcap 250. The sector relevance of Archean Chemical Industries is anchored in its role within the broader Indian specialty chemicals industry, where it competes with other diversified chemical companies. As part of this industry, the company’s strategic positioning connects marine chemicals, bromine, industrial salt, and sulphate of potash that serve multiple end-user segments. Competitors in adjacent segments include companies such as Aarti Surfactants Ltd., Aether Industries Ltd., Alkali Metals Ltd., Ami Organics Ltd., Anupam Rasayan India Ltd., and Clean Science and Technology Ltd. Globally, the company faces competition from companies like Arkema, Clariant, and Scimplify.
